WebFeb 25, 2024 · In sum, any real estate owned for investment purposes can be owned by an IRA. The law has very few restrictions on assets owned by a retirement account. In fact, the only investment assets restricted for IRAs is life insurance, collectible items (e.g. art, antique car), and s-corporation stock. IRC 408 (m); IRC 408 (a) (3); IRC § 1361 (b) (1) (B).
